Start Date-End Date: 03/17/2014-05/17/2014 Land Manager Office: USFS - Saguache Ranger District Land Manager Contact: Jim Pitts Funding Partner: National Civilian Community Corps Programmatic Partner: Summary: NCCC 2nd group 2014 (USFS, Saguache ranger District Rio Grande National Forest Description: Volunteers with the Americorps NCCC crew hosted by the Mountain Valley K-12 School will assist the Saguache Ranger District with a variety of tasks from March 17th to May 17th. The level of physical activity required will vary from light to difficult. All necessary tools and equipment will be provided by the Forest Service. If a government vehicle is required for tasks, Volunteers must complete USFS driver training. All neccesary Risk Management Assesment Worksheets will be completed on an as needed baisis. Volunteers will track their own hours on a Volunteer Timesheet and submit to Brink Messick at the end of every month. Volunteers will be required to behave in a manner appropriate to the workplace. List of prohibited activities: ? Possession or use of firearms except when authorized (Health and Safety Code Handbook, Chapter 17) ? Consumption of intoxicating beverages ? Possession or use of any illegal drugs (including medicinal marijuana) ? Use of Government -owned or Government-leased vehicles, property, tools, equipment, or telephones except as provided in the volunteer agreement ? Fighting, use of derogatory language, intimidating behavior, discrimination, sexual harassment, violent or threatening behavior ? Possession of pets without special permission of the district ranger or line officer ? Violation of any State game and fish regulation ? Violation of any Federal, State, or local law ? Selling of distributing non-agency products or literature in a Forest Service facility ? Disclosing confidential information Violation of any of the above prohibitions may constitute grounds for dismissal or other disciplinary action.
